Sound Recording, North Yorkshire

Description

Tony Chambers, recorded in Ripon, talks about mumming and joining the Ripon Sword Dancers in 1962; lists other members and when they joined; learning lines; parts; costumes; dancing and music as part of the play in the past; the name Sword Dancers; performance locations, including local houses and Cayton Hall, student invitations; Ripon Tourist Board request; the timing of the performances; new performers; swords; Chambers family involvement; rehearsals; the route taken by the performers; tradition and meaning behind the play; the characters; drinking and pub performances; performing on a Monday if Boxing Day falls on a Sunday; the collection; preference for performing on housing estates to pubs; the audience; the future of the play. 23 of 39.
